Background

Enjoy the vibrant history of Cartagena by delving into its captivating background. Cartagena’s historical context is rich and diverse, shaped by centuries of conquests, trade, and cultural exchange. The city’s strategic location made it a prime target for European powers seeking to control the valuable resources of the New World. Its walls, built to protect against pirate attacks, stand as a testament to its turbulent past.

The cultural significance of Cartagena lies in its unique blend of African, indigenous, and European influences, which are evident in its architecture, cuisine, and traditions.

The city’s UNESCO World Heritage status highlights its importance as a cultural and historical gem worth exploring.

Cartagena’s history is a tapestry of resilience, survival, and adaptation, making it a fascinating destination for those eager to uncover the layers of its past.
